Stop Clogs
Among the most obvious factors for cleaning your bathroom drains pipes monthly is to avoid obstructions. A whole lot extra decreases the drainpipe than you would think-- skin flakes, eyelashes, dust, and hair. All of these fragments collect as well as ultimately trigger obstructions. Also a minor clog can make your sink or shower essentially unusable. When you tidy your drains frequently, you will not end up with deep clogs that require strong chemicals and expert tools. While you can clean your bathroom drains pipes on your own, we advise that you call a plumber to properly clean your drains a few times each year.

Determine Underlying Issues
When you clean your drainpipe once a month, you can identify underlying problems prior to they come to be severe issues. For instance, if you see particles coming out of your bathroom drains with a serpent cleaner, they could be rusting. Any type of irregular items coming out of a drainpipe ought to increase problems. If it is not just the normal hair and also substance, you should get in touch with a plumber to see if your washroom drains pipes demand to be fixed.

Stop Comprehensive Damage
As stated, frequently cleansing your shower room drains pipes can aid determine underlying concerns that are more severe than a sink clogged with hair. The ordinary price to fix a drain line is $696, which is a lot more expensive than the plain $10 it requires to cleanse your drains regular monthly. Serious obstructions can damage your entire plumbing system and also even have an effect on the general public systems and also the top quality of water.

Reason for Having Clogged Drain
One of the main reasons drains become clogged is all the hair that goes down them. You can install a drain catch in your shower or bathtub to prevent this from happening. This will capture the hair before it can go down the drain and cause a blockage. You should also regularly clean the drain catch – otherwise, it will fill up with hair over time.
Another common cause of clogged drains is soap scum. Soap scum is a build-up of soap residue, body oils, and dirt that gets stuck to the sides of your drain. If left unchecked, soap scum can eventually lead to a complete blockage. To prevent this, you should regularly clean your drain with a mild cleanser. You can also use a plunger to remove any build-up that has already occurred.
If your drains are still giving you trouble, there are a few other things you can try. One option is to pour boiling water down the drain – this will help to break up any clogs that may be present. Another option is to use a plumbers’ snake – a long, flexible tool that can reach deep into the drain and clear any obstructions. If all else fails, you may need to call in a professional plumber to take care of the problem for you.
